Ben Richards

Researcher

Ben joined the SMF in March 2014. Ben works on projects including an analysis of the expenditure patterns of households on low incomes, and an assessment of key areas of focus for business policy leading up to the 2015 general election. His other research interests include theories of social justice, and debates on multiculturalism and social solidarity.

Ben recently completed a PhD in Social Policy at the London School of Economics, and has previously worked as a Researcher at the Centre for Analysis of Social Exclusion, LSE. He has also conducted research for charities including Oxfam and the Child Poverty Action Group.
